Agriventure Humitite Composition & Technical Details
 Composition:
 
 
 | Component | Percentage | 
 
 | Super Potassium Humate Flakes | 98% | 
 
 | Humic Acid | 70% | 
 
 | Fulvic | 6% | 
 
 | K2O | 8 To 10% |

Agriventure Humitite Usage & Crops
 Recommended Crops: Rice, Wheat, Sugarcane, Orchards, Cotton Chilies, Banana, Soybean, Groundnut, Vegetables, Fruits, Flowers, Major Plantation Crops, Medicinal and Aromatic Plants, and all other crops especially High-Value Crops.
 Method of Application & Dosage:
 
 - 
 Foliar Spray: 1-2 gm / L of water
- 
 Drenching: 2-3 gm / L of water
- 
 Drip irrigation: 0.5-1 Kg / Acre
